介绍了单火嘴单区烧氨技术在中国石油辽阳石化分公司炼油厂硫磺回收装置的应用情况.重点介绍了烧氨技术的原理,对单火嘴单区和双区这2种烧氨技术进行对比.实践证明:处理含烃高的酸性气的硫磺回收装置宜采用单火嘴单区烧氨技术.该硫磺回收装置硫磺转化率达99.88%,排放尾气ρ(SO2)为307 mg/m^3,系统阻力降保持在10 kPa左右. 相似文献

介绍了国内外炼油厂酸性气处理技术的现状,综述了酸性气回收制硫磺、亚硫酸胺、硫氢化钠、硫脲的工艺技术,对比分析了小型炼油厂几种酸性气处理工艺的技术来源、适用规模、技术成熟度、脱硫效率、产品前景及运行成本等方面,并为小型炼油厂的酸性气处理提供了具体建议:对于小型炼油厂建酸性气处理装置,可选择LO-CAT回收制硫磺技术或回收制硫氢化钠工艺;对于建设1kt/a左右的小规模硫回收装置,更适合采用回收制硫氢化钠工艺。 相似文献

普光气田天然气净化厂联合装置运行简介 总被引:2,自引:0,他引:2
普光气田天然气净化厂是中国石化集团公司"川气东送工程"的关键组成部分,位于川东北达州地区宣汉县普光镇赵家坝,占地3402亩,总投资130.28亿元。从2005年开始选址、设计、施工,至2009年10月第一联合装置投料试车成功,历时近五年时间。工程设计建设6套联合装置(12个系列,单列处理能力300万方/天,总处理能力120亿方/年)、配套公用工程、硫磺储运装置及硫磺外运专用铁道。[1]工厂引进了国外先进成熟的天然气净化工艺包。工艺装置主要包括脱硫、脱水、硫磺回收、尾气处理、硫磺成型和酸性水汽提装置,采用MDEA法脱硫、三甘醇法脱水、常规克劳斯二级转化法回收硫磺、加氢还原吸收尾气处理和酸水汽提的工艺技术路线;以普光气田高含硫天然气为原料(硫化氢14.5%,二氧化碳8.8%),年处理能力120亿方(日处理能力3600万方),净化气能力90亿方,硫磺能力220万吨,是国内建设的第一个百亿方级高含硫天然气净化厂,综合处理能力和硫磺产量位居世界前列。 相似文献

2011年12月8日,中国化工集团山东昌邑石化有限公司50kt·a^-1硫磺回收装置一次开车成功,顺利生产出合格的硫磺产品。该装置采用ROA还原氧化吸收新工艺,包括酸性气部分燃烧技术、二级克劳斯硫回收技术、SO2选择性还原技术、H2S选择性氧化技术和尾气催化氧化吸收技术等,同时采用酸性气燃烧先进控制技术、尾气深冷技术以及组合催化剂技术等四项专利,属国内首创,弥补了传统克劳斯硫磺回收工艺的不足。 相似文献

责任是人应主动承担的角色义务和对其因过失所造成后果应承担的责罚.有两层涵义:一是义务;二是后果.责任心是个体自觉做好分内事务和履行道德义务的心理倾向,是个性心理品质成分中自我特征维度上的重要内容.责任心具有两个方面的涵义:一是角色分内职责;二是角色道德义务.责任心是一种通过责任认知、责任个性和责任适应的动态形式表现出来的静态品质,责任心是责任心过程结构与责任心关系结构相互制约、相互影响的统一体. 相似文献

Abstract Kinetics and mechanisms of oxidation of 6 acetals by molecular oxygen and ozone in liquid phase have been studied. Reaction with molecular oxygen (70°C, 15–16 hr) leads to the formation monoethers of the corresponding glycols with 68–90% selectivity. Salts of metals and complexes with crown-ethers have increased the reaction rate significally. Ozone have reacted with acetals with formation similar products. The mechanisms of intermediate stages have been proposed. 相似文献

The variation of the Au 4f binding energy of Au clusters with the cluster size has been established by measuring the binding energies of clusters whose size distributions were independently determined by HREM and STM. The binding energy increases significantly when the cluster size is less than 2 nm. Au-Cu bimetallic clusters of the composition Cu3Au have been deposited for the first time on carbon substrates. The shifts in the core level binding energies of the bimetallic clusters show the effect of alloying in the case of large clusters, but show effects of both alloying and cluster size in the case of the small clusters. The interaction of CO with Cu3Au clusters is stronger than with a bulk Cu metal. The interaction of CO with small Cu clusters also seems to be stronger than with bulk Cu or with large Cu clusters. 相似文献

This work deals with modelling of emulsion polymerization processes using batch and semi-batch reactors. Specific attention is paid to copolymerization of the system styrene/butyl acrylate.The main key parameters of the model are identified on the basis of batch experimental data in order to describe the complete sketch of emulsion polymerization. The model is then used to simulate, under several operating conditions, the polymerization rate, the global monomers conversion, the number and weight average molecular weights as well as the particle size distribution and the glass transition temperature. Then, the model is generalized to the use of semi-batch processes and validated for this application. 相似文献

This study aimed to investigate the structural features, antioxidant activity, tyrosinase inhibitory effect, and mechanism of proanthocyanidins from leaf and fruit of Leucaena leucocephala. MALDI-TOF-MS, thiolysis coupled with HPLC-ESI-MS, and 13C-NMR confirmed that these proanthocyanidins were complex mixtures of propelargonidins, procyanidins, and prodelphinidins. (Epi)catechin, (epi)gallocatechin, (epi)catechin gallate, and (epi)gallocatechin gallate were the main constitutive units. The findings obtained from enzyme analysis revealed that the proanthocyanidins had inhibitory effects on both monophenolase and diphenolase of tyrosinase. The IC50 values of leaf and fruit proanthocyanidins were 73.5?±?2.7 and 52.3?±?3.5 µg/mL for monophenolase activity, and 27.2?±?1.4 and 16.1?±?1.1 µg/mL for diphenolase activity, respectively. The inhibition of diphenolase by proanthocyanidins were proved to be reversible and mixed type. In addition, it was also found from various antioxidant methods that the proanthocyanidins in leaf and fruit possessed potent DPPH radical scavenging activity with IC50 values of 103.4?±?0.8 and 87.8?±?1.1 µg/mL, ABTS radical scavenging activity with IC50 values of 72.9?±?0.4 and 65.7?±?0.9 µg/mL, and ferric reducing antioxidant power with FRAP values of 3.74?±?0.03 and 4.02?±?0.15?mmol AAE/g, respectively. The results obtained suggested that the proanthocyanidins from leaf and fruit of L. leucocephala might have the potential to be exploited as natural tyrosinase inhibitors and antioxidants. 相似文献
